    The Committee on Rules, having had under consideration 
House Resolution 186, by a record vote of 7 to 3, report the 
same to the House with the recommendation that the resolution 
be adopted.

                  summary of provisions of resolution

    The resolution provides for the consideration in the House 
of H.R. 1259, the ``Social Security and Medicare Safe Deposit 
Box Act of 1999,'' under a closed rule. The rule provides two 
hours of debate divided equally between the chairmen and 
ranking minority members of the Committees on the Budget, 
Rules, and Ways and Means.
    The rule provides that the bill be considered as read and 
that the amendment printed in section 2 of the resolution be 
considered as adopted.
    Finally, the rule provides for one motion to recommit, with 
or without instructions.

                            committee votes

    Pursuant to clause 3(b) of House rule XIII the results of 
each record vote on an amendment or motion to report, together 
with the names of those voting for and against, are printed 
below:

Rules Committee record vote No. 26

    Date: May 24, 1999.
    Measure: H.R. 1259, Social Security and Medicare Safe 
Deposit Box Act of 1999.
    Motion by: Mr. Frost.
    Summary of motion: To make in order a minority substitute 
amendment offered by Representatives Spratt, Moakley, and 
Rangel.
    Results: Defeated 3 to 7.
    Vote by Members: Goss--Nay; Linder--Nay; Diaz-Balart--Nay; 
Hastings--Nay; Myrick--Nay; Sessions--Nay; Frost--Yea; Hall--
Yea; Slaughter--Yea; Dreier--Nay.

Rules Committee record vote No. 27

    Date: May 24, 1999.
    Measure: H.R. 1259, Social Security and Medicare Safe 
Deposit Box Act of 1999.
    Motion by: Mr. Goss.
    Summary of motion: To report the resolution.
    Results: Adopted 7 to 3.
    Vote by Members: Goss--Yea; Linder--Yea; Diaz-Balart--Yea; 
Hastings--Yea; Myrick--Yea; Sessions--Yea; Frost--Nay; Hall--
Nay; Slaughter--Nay; Dreier--Yea.
